The Core Gameplay Experience

At its heart, Geometry Dash 2 is a rhythm-based platformer. Players control a perpetually moving geometric icon, typically a square, which automatically progresses forward. The player's role is to interact with the environment, primarily by making the icon jump. This action is performed using the mouse, a simple yet effective control scheme that belies the game's depth. The challenge escalates as the game introduces various forms of terrain and environmental elements. Platforms appear, requiring precise jumps to land on, while gaps necessitate well-timed leaps to clear. The environments are not static; they are dynamic and often hazardous. Spikes, saw blades, and other deadly obstacles are strategically placed to impede progress. Colliding with any of these elements results in immediate failure, sending the player back to the beginning of the current level or to a designated checkpoint.

The visual style of Geometry Dash 2 is characterized by its bright, bold colors and sharp, geometric designs. This aesthetic contributes to the game's energetic and fast-paced nature. The synchronized soundtrack plays a crucial role, often dictating the rhythm of the level. Players are encouraged to listen to the music and anticipate the obstacles that appear in time with the beat. This integration of audio and visual cues is a hallmark of the Geometry Dash series and is expertly implemented here. The levels are designed to flow seamlessly with the music, creating a captivating and immersive experience. As players advance, the complexity of the levels increases exponentially. New mechanics are introduced, such as gravity-changing portals, teleportation pads, and sections where the player controls different vehicles like rockets or UFOs, each with its own unique movement patterns and challenges. Mastering these variations is key to achieving success.

Mastering the Controls: A Simple Yet Demanding Interface

The control mechanism for Geometry Dash 2 on Unblocked Games 6X is remarkably straightforward, utilizing only the mouse. This simplicity is a deliberate design choice, allowing players to focus entirely on the visual cues and the rhythmic patterns of the levels rather than struggling with complex button inputs. The primary action is a single click of the mouse, which initiates a jump for the geometric icon. The duration of the mouse press can also influence the height of the jump, adding a subtle layer of control that is essential for navigating different obstacles and platform heights. This "hold to jump higher" mechanic is fundamental to the game's strategic depth.

In certain segments of the game, the player might encounter specialized portals that alter the icon's form and movement. For instance, a yellow portal might transform the standard icon into a flying rocket that requires players to click and hold the mouse to ascend and release to descend. Similarly, a green portal might switch the icon's gravity, causing it to fall upwards. Each of these transformations introduces a new set of challenges and requires players to adapt their timing and control strategies on the fly. The game masterfully guides players through these new mechanics, typically introducing them in simpler contexts before integrating them into more complex level designs. The absence of complex controls ensures that anyone can pick up and play Geometry Dash 2, but achieving mastery requires dedication and practice to truly understand the nuances of each jump, flight, and gravitational shift.

The Importance of Rhythm and Music

One of the defining characteristics of Geometry Dash 2 is its intrinsic connection to its soundtrack. The game's levels are not merely overlaid on music; they are designed in sync with it. The beat drops, melodies, and tempo changes often correspond directly to the appearance of obstacles, the introduction of new mechanics, or challenging sequences. This synchronization transforms the game from a simple reaction-based challenge into a rhythmic dance. Players who pay close attention to the music will find it significantly easier to anticipate upcoming obstacles and time their jumps. The music provides an auditory roadmap, guiding players through the intricate designs.

The soundtrack itself is typically energetic and electronic, featuring a variety of genres that complement the game's fast-paced action. As players progress through different levels, the music and visual themes often change, offering a fresh experience with each new environment. This integration ensures that the game remains engaging and stimulating, preventing the repetitive nature of the core gameplay from becoming monotonous. The harmonious interplay between the visuals, the gameplay mechanics, and the music is what elevates Geometry Dash 2 beyond a typical browser game, offering a truly cohesive and captivating experience. Mastering the rhythm is as crucial as mastering the controls, and the best players are those who can seamlessly blend both.

Challenges and Progression: A Test of Endurance

Geometry Dash 2 is renowned for its challenging nature. The game does not shy away from presenting players with difficult obstacles and demanding sequences. This difficulty is not intended to be frustrating but rather to be rewarding when overcome. Each failed attempt is a learning opportunity, allowing players to identify patterns, memorize timings, and refine their strategies. The game often features a practice mode, allowing players to place checkpoints at various points in a level, enabling them to focus on mastering specific sections without having to restart from the very beginning every time. This feature is invaluable for tackling the more demanding levels.

Progression in Geometry Dash 2 is marked by the completion of levels. As players successfully navigate through each stage, they unlock new ones, each offering a greater challenge and more intricate designs. The game also often features secret coins or collectibles within levels, which can unlock additional content, such as new icons or color schemes for the player's avatar. These optional challenges add another layer of replayability and cater to players who seek to complete every aspect of the game. The sense of accomplishment derived from finally beating a level that previously seemed insurmountable is a powerful motivator. It’s a journey of perseverance, where each small victory builds towards a larger triumph. The ultimate goal for many players is to complete all the official levels, demonstrating a mastery of the game's mechanics and a remarkable level of skill.
